  5. Dramus

    Cabling: cat 5e or 6

    What TonyR said. I ran Cat6 stranded to all my cameras because some of the physical routing was torturous and I already had a bag-full of Cat6 terminations for stranded cable. They're essentially very long patch cables :). But Cat5E is more than plenty for IP cameras.

  9. Dramus

    Warning about tool shipped with Dahua cams!

    The housings are aluminium. The screws are allegedly some form of stainless steel. The result will be galvanic corrosion in the presence of moisture. Anti-seize might not be a bad idea.
